Persistent Fatigue That Never Truly Goes Away
When Tiredness Becomes a Health Concern
Everyone feels tired occasionally. However, constant exhaustion that continues after proper rest usually signals a deeper issue.
Several conditions may cause ongoing fatigue, including:
- Iron deficiency
- Thyroid imbalance
- Chronic stress
- Vitamin B12 deficiency
- Sleep apnea
- Blood sugar fluctuations
In addition, fatigue often affects concentration, mood, and productivity. People may struggle to focus at work, lose motivation, or feel mentally drained throughout the day.
Why People Commonly Ignore Fatigue
Many people blame busy schedules for their exhaustion. Parents, office workers, students, and shift employees often believe feeling tired is normal. However, the body should recover after quality sleep. If exhaustion continues daily, it deserves attention.
Frequent Headaches That Keep Returning
What Repeated Headaches May Reveal
Occasional headaches happen to almost everyone. Still, recurring headaches can point to hidden health problems.
Common causes include:
- Dehydration
- Eye strain
- Poor posture
- High blood pressure
- Hormonal changes
- Stress and tension
Furthermore, headache patterns often reveal useful clues.
| Headache Pattern | Possible Cause |
|---|---|
| Morning headaches | Sleep disorders or high blood pressure |
| Headaches after screen use | Eye strain or tension |
| One-sided throbbing pain | Migraine triggers |
| Headaches with dizziness | Circulation or hydration problems |
How Stress Intensifies Headaches
Stress increases muscle tension and inflammation throughout the body. Consequently, many people develop chronic headaches without realizing stress plays a major role.
Over time, the body stays in a constant state of alertness, which makes headaches more frequent and more painful.
Skin Changes That Signal Internal Problems
Your Skin Reflects Your Overall Health
Your skin often reveals internal imbalances before other symptoms appear. Therefore, sudden skin changes should never be ignored.
Some examples include:
- Pale skin linked to anemia
- Yellowish skin connected to liver issues
- Dark patches associated with insulin resistance
- Persistent acne triggered by hormonal imbalance
In addition, dryness, itchiness, or unexplained irritation may indicate nutritional deficiencies or inflammation inside the body.
When Skin Symptoms Need Immediate Attention
You should pay close attention if skin changes appear suddenly, spread quickly, or refuse to heal. Although some conditions remain harmless, others may point to underlying medical problems.

Sudden Hair Loss or Hair Thinning
What Hair Changes Can Reveal
Hair health often reflects internal nutrition and hormone balance. Therefore, sudden hair shedding may indicate more than a cosmetic problem.
Possible causes include:
- Low iron levels
- Thyroid disorders
- Protein deficiency
- Emotional stress
- Hormonal imbalance
Moreover, stress-related hair loss commonly appears several weeks after a stressful event, which makes the connection easy to miss.
Why Nutrition Plays a Major Role
Your hair needs vitamins, minerals, and protein to grow properly. Without enough nutrients, the body prioritizes essential organs instead of hair growth.
As a result, hair becomes weaker, thinner, and easier to shed.
Unusual Food Cravings That Keep Happening
Why Your Body Craves Certain Foods
Food cravings sometimes reveal nutritional deficiencies rather than simple hunger.
For example:
- Ice cravings may suggest iron deficiency
- Sugar cravings may reflect unstable blood sugar
- Salt cravings can indicate dehydration
- Chocolate cravings sometimes connect to magnesium deficiency
Although occasional cravings remain normal, intense cravings that happen repeatedly may deserve closer attention.
How Poor Diets Increase Cravings
Processed foods often create blood sugar spikes and crashes. Consequently, the body starts craving quick energy sources more frequently.
Over time, this cycle can affect mood, energy, and metabolism.
Sleep Problems That Damage Your Health
Why Poor Sleep Affects the Entire Body
Sleep allows the body to repair itself. However, many people consistently sacrifice sleep because of work, stress, or digital distractions.
Poor sleep can contribute to:
- Hormonal imbalance
- Weak immunity
- Weight gain
- Memory problems
- Mood swings
In addition, people who sleep poorly often experience lower energy throughout the day.
Warning Signs You Should Not Ignore
Pay attention if you regularly experience:
- Loud snoring
- Frequent waking during the night
- Difficulty falling asleep
- Waking up exhausted
- Gasping for air while sleeping
These symptoms may indicate conditions such as insomnia or sleep apnea.

Tingling Hands and Numbness
Why Nerve Symptoms Matter
Occasional numbness happens sometimes, especially after sleeping awkwardly. However, repeated tingling or numbness may signal nerve or circulation problems.
Possible causes include:
- Vitamin deficiencies
- Diabetes
- Poor circulation
- Nerve compression
- Neurological disorders
Furthermore, untreated nerve problems may worsen over time.
Where Symptoms Usually Begin
Most people first notice numbness in the:
- Fingers
- Hands
- Feet
- Toes
Therefore, recurring tingling sensations should never be ignored for long periods.
Shortness of Breath During Simple Activities
What Breathing Changes Can Mean
Feeling slightly out of breath after intense exercise feels normal. However, struggling to breathe during simple daily activities may indicate a serious issue.
Potential causes include:
- Heart conditions
- Lung problems
- Anemia
- Anxiety disorders
- Poor cardiovascular health
When Breathing Problems Become Dangerous
Seek medical attention immediately if shortness of breath occurs alongside:
- Chest pain
- Severe dizziness
- Blue lips
- Sudden weakness
These symptoms may signal a medical emergency.
